The Governor signed Public Act 96-0889 into law creating a second-tier of benefits for future members of the General Assembly Retirement System.

Senate Bill 1946 outlines a two-tier pension system that changes benefits for anyone hired on or after January 1, 2011.





Civil Union Law Highlights
Benefits for Parties to a Civil Union

Effective June 1, 2011, all pension benefits previously made available to a married person and his or her spouse, are now benefits available to the parties to a civil union.  Parties may be same sex or opposite sex couples.
